Role Overview
We are looking for a Manager of Lifecycle Marketing to own and scale our customer communication strategy across the entire funnel. From first touch to conversion and post-purchase engagement. This role is highly operational and strategic, with a strong emphasis on Hub Spot expertise, long-cycle decision journeys, and performance-driven messaging.
You will be responsible for designing, building, and optimizing email and SMS programs, including both automated lifecycle flows and promotional campaigns, to drive qualified pipeline, revenue, and customer engagement.
This role is ideal for someone who thrives in complex buyer journeys, understands how to nurture high-intent leads over weeks or months, and can turn CRM data into timely, relevant, high-impact communications.
This position blends strategic ownership with hands-on execution. You will be accountable for email cadence, list health, testing, and performance while partnering closely with design, content, and development teams to deliver a cohesive, on-brand experience.
Responsibilities- Own the end-to-end lifecycle marketing strategy across lead, prospect, customer, and post-purchase stages
- Map and continuously refine lifecycle stages aligned with long consideration, high-ticket D2C purchase journeys
- Partner with Sales, Growth, and Product teams to ensure lifecycle programs support pipeline velocity and revenue goals
- Build, manage, and optimize automated workflows (lead nurture, re-engagement, abandonment, qualification, post-purchase, upsell, referral)
- Plan and execute promotional campaigns via email and SMS, ensuring proper targeting, timing, and frequency
- Own channel performance (deliverability, open rates, CTR, conversion, unsubscribes) and continuously optimize
- Serve as the Hub Spot power user and lifecycle subject-matter expert
- Build and maintain workflows, lists, properties, lead scoring models, and segmentation logic
- Ensure clean data hygiene and accurate lifecycle tracking
- Collaborate with Rev Ops to improve CRM structure, reporting, and attribution
- Leverage AI for automation and personalization.
- Design nurture programs that support complex buying decisions (e.g., vehicles, luxury goods, high-consideration products)
- Balance education, trust-building, and promotional messaging over extended timelines
- Use behavioral, demographic, and intent signals to personalize messaging at scale
- Define KPIs for lifecycle performance (MQL to SQL conversion, pipeline contribution, revenue influenced, LTV, churn)
- Run A/B tests on messaging, cadence, offers, and timing
- Produce insights and recommendations based on lifecycle performance data
